External hydraulic crushing anti-blocking ore-drawing system
The external hydraulic crushing and anti-blocking ore discharge system uses pressure detection and image acquisition to remotely control the unblocking mechanism, solving the problem of large ore blockage in traditional ore discharge machines and improving automation and safety.

Traditional vibratory ore feeders are prone to jamming when dealing with unevenly sized ore pieces after blasting, containing a large number of large pieces of ore. They also have a low degree of automation and pose significant safety hazards.
An external hydraulic crushing and anti-blocking ore discharge system is adopted, which includes an ore discharge device, a dredging mechanism, a pressure detection unit, and a control unit. By combining pressure detection and image acquisition, the dredging mechanism can be remotely controlled to perform crushing, turning, or flipping actions to solve the problem of large ore blockage.
It has achieved automated ore dredging, avoiding the safety hazards of secondary blasting and manual handling, improving the intelligence and ease of operation of the equipment, and reducing labor intensity.
